Overview

Mr. Timberlake has over thirty eight years of experience spanning areas that include the design and
construction of highway projects, engineering applications in the aggregate industry, and land surveying.
He began his career with the Indiana State Highway Commission as an inspector on Interstate 64 during
college. Upon graduation he spent a year in the graduate engineer training program, spending time in
road design, bridge design, testing and traffic at the central office in Indianapolis. He worked as permit
engineer in the Seymour District and as a project engineer in the Vincennes District. He then advanced
to area engineer, supervising construction of highway projects in southwest Indiana. He began working
for Mulzer Crushed Stone Company in 1989 as the Company Engineer in charge of engineering and
surveying operations. The work included design of barge fleeting and aggregate unloading facilities and
the design and construction of aggregate processing facilities. In 2000 he left Mulzer Crushed Stone to
expand the operations of Timberlake Engineering, a Civil Engineering and Land Surveying firm he had
started in the early 1980’s.

PROJECT SPECIFIC EXPERIENCE

Highway Experience- Indiana State Highway Commission and Indiana Department of Highways
  • Project Engineer, State Road 66 in Tell City, Indiana: Project Engineer in charge of urban road
    construction widening, re-construction and addition of turn lanes and traffic signals on State Road 66 in
    Tell City, Indiana. Computed quantities and prepared estimates for payment to the contractor.
    Project Engineer, Bridge on State Road 66 at Grandview, Indiana: Project Engineer in charge of the
    removal of an existing concrete arch bridge and the construction of a new concrete I- beam bridge.
    Computed quantities and prepared estimates for payment to the contractor. Prepared final construction
    record.
  • Project Engineer, Contract R-12062, State Road 66 in Cannelton, Indiana: Project Engineer in charge
    of a road construction project from Greenmeadow Drive to the Cannelton Lock and Dam. Computed
    quantities and prepared estimates for payment to the contractor. Prepared final construction record.
  • Project Engineer, Traffic Signal Installation at the Intersection of State Road 56 and US 231 in Jasper,
    Indiana: Project Engineer in charge of layout and construction of a traffic actuated signal system.
  • Project Engineer, Paint Striping, Vincennes District: Project Engineer in charge of a paint striping
    contract involving several State Roads in the Vincennes District.
  • Project Engineer, Herbicide Treatment Contract: Project Engineer in charge of the application of
    herbicide on various roads in the Vincennes District.
  • Design and Layout: Engineer in charge of initial curve design, layout in field, cross sections,
    topographical survey and survey ties to property corners for State Road 66 “White Oak Hill Project”
    south of Marengo, Indiana. A portion of this road was constructed to remove a dangerous horizontal
    curve.
  • Assistant Project Engineer, State Road 37, St. Croix, Perry County County, Indiana: Engineer on new
    construction of State Road 37. Duties included performing on-site soil and concrete tests and surveying
    lines, grades, slope stakes, right of way, and large drainage structures. Other engineering work included
    taking initial and final cross sections for computation of earthwork quantities. Special engineering work
    on this project involved slide repairs and construction of shale fills.
  • Engineering Assistant, Interstate 64, Contracts R-8828, R-9967: Performed testing on soil and concrete.
    Worked in a survey crew staking centerline, running level circuits, slope staking, setting grades, staking
    pipes, staking right of way, and setting bridge control stakes. Inspector at asphalt plant. Computed
    earthwork quantities from cross sections.
  • Misc: Attended various training courses at the research and Training Center in West Lafayette, Indiana.
    Courses included training in surveying, plan reading, office manager 19 point filing system and use of the
    troxler nuclear density testing device.

ENGINEERING MANAGEMENT EXPERIENCE- PRIVATE

Mulzer Crushed Stone Company: Company Engineer in charge of engineering design, layout and
construction of aggregate processing facilities in three states. Trained in the use of Autocad/Survcadd
software.
  • Directed design and construction of barge fleeting and loading and unloading facilities on the Ohio River in Indiana and Kentucky, and designed barge fleeting facilities on the Kanawha River in West Virginia. Review of Aggregate Testing issues.
  • Committee member of INDOT Certified Aggregate Technician Program and involved in the preparation of the first training manual. Participated in the program as an instructor at the INDOT Certified Aggregate Technician School.
  • Supervised environmental activities. Environmental permitting including Rule 5 and Rule 6 stormwater permits, NPDES water discharge permits, and air permits for concrete and aggregate plants. Oversaw stormwater monitoring at various aggregate facilities. Received certification as a Method 9 air emissions tester. In charge of the design and construction of a 2 acre salt pad with retention basin in Hugheston, WV.
  • In charge of surveying activities in Indiana, Kentucky and West Virginia. Performed hydrographic surveys for river cross sections. Performed boundary surveys at quarries which varied in size from a few hundred acres up to 2000 acres. Directed the measurement and calculation of stockpile inventories. Researched mining leases.
  • Engineering design which included the design of a wall and roof system for Charlestown Quarry tipple and involvement in the planning and the layout of a new plant at Cape Sandy. This required the design of a steel surge bin and conveyor system. Designed a barge mounted “ski-ramp” to allow dumping of R-35 quarry pit trucks directly on to barges. Designed new garage facility and raised mound septic system for Griffin Sand Pit and a new garage facility at Mulzer’s main office in Tell City, Indiana. Worked on the design, layout, and permitting for startup of the Abydel Quarry in Orange County, Indiana. In charge of permitting, zoning activities, and design of truck/ barge loading facility for the startup of the New Amsterdam Quarry. Designed alignment, grades and right of way a county road re-location.
  • INDOT related activities included preparation of the annual source reports for the various Mulzer aggregate facilities including geologic profiles at each quarry.
  • Involved with starting GPS barge positioning for tracking and plotting dredging activities on the Ohio River.
  • Environmental work included involvement with wetland delineation and the design and development of mitigation areas and an annual mussel bed survey on the Ohio River. Permitting new green field sites involved extensive experience with archaeological issues involved with new construction.

ENGINEERING FIRM EXPERIENCE

Private Engineering & Surveying Firm
Timberlake Engineering: A Civil Engineering and Land Surveying firm involved in the design and layout of
civil engineering works and the execution of topographical, hydrological, boundary and cadastral survey
projects including ALTA and flood elevation mapping.
  • River design work includes the Alton Boat Ramp project on the Ohio River for the Town
    of Alton. Design of the Cannelton Boat Ramp project on the Ohio River for the Town of
    Cannelton. Design of the Rome Boat Ramp project on the Ohio River for the Perry County Parks
    Board and the Design of the Troy Boat Ramp project on the Ohio River for the Town of Troy.
    These projects were a part of the Indiana Waterways program administered by the Indiana
    Department of Natural Resources.
  • Aggregate industry work includes stormwater pollution prevention planning and the
    preparation of INDOT aggregate source reports. An underground survey of the former Hyrock
    Quarry was conducted which included preparation of a map of the tunnels and amount of
    surface cover above the tunnels in relation to property lines. A report of the mineral aggregate
    reserves was made for the Mathis Quarry in Harrison County, Indiana.
  • Reclamation plans for quarries and sand and gravel operations have been prepared for
    Marin Marietta, Mulzer Crushed Stone, Hilltop Basic Resources, U. S. Aggregates, Engineering
    Aggregates, Heritage Aggregates, Spray Sand & Gravel, Corydon Stone & Asphalt, Sellersburg
    Stone, Barrett Paving Materials, Eagle Materials and North American Limestone.
  • Building design work includes the design of a new six bay Firehouse for the Town of English, the
    design of Tower Full Gospel Church and the design of the Tunnel Hill Methodist Church. Recent
    project are the design of an addition to the Marengo American Legion Post 84, design of the
    Crawford County Health Care Center at Marengo and design of the Carefree Truckwash.
  • Surveying work includes approximately 200 topographical and boundary surveys per year using
    Electronic Distance measuring equipment, GPS and leveling. Several subdivisions have been
    designed and approved in various counties. Several FEMA flood elevation determinations have
    been made in southern Indiana.
  • Site development work includes the site topography and the construction layout of the
    Crawford County Judicial Complex and the site layout for construction of an expansion to Eagle
    Steel at Clark Maritime Center in Jeffersonville, Indiana.
  • Miscellaneous engineering work includes the design of several commercial driveways for INDOT
    applications, the design, layout and DNR permitting of a private bridge in Harrison County and
    the layout and route planning of a county bridge as Crawford County Surveyor. Soil testing of
    apartment complex project in Tell City, Indiana, including standard proctor densities and on site
    compaction testing.
